Cascade Brewing Bottles Nectarine Dream for the First Time

Cascade Brewing (Portland, Oregon) has officially announced that it will begin the Limited Release of Nectarine Dream 2019 on Friday, July 10.

Releasing for the first time ever in bottles, Nectarine Dream 2019 (7.5% ABV) is a “blend of sour blond ales aged in oak barrels and foudres for up to 18 months, then naturally fermented with fresh, Northwest grown nectarines and aged on the fruit for an additional five months.” To ensure that the added fruit is represented properly in Nectarine Dream, the crew at Cascade “hand [processed] each piece of fruit to ensure full ripeness before adding it to the tank and [employed] traditional wine making techniques that help capture the purest expression of the nectarine as well as the time and place in which it was grown.”

Nectarine Dream 2019 will officially release at Cascade’s two Portland pubs – Cascade Brewing Barrel House and Lodge at Cascade Brewing – on July 10 and distribution will follow shortly after the on-site release. You can expect to find this Limited Release available in 500ml bottles & on draft at select craft beer-focused establishments located in Alabama, Florida, Oregon and throughout the rest of Cascade Brewing’s distribution area.
